Pros: Great PCI card, allows you to add extra SATA ports onto your PC and use them for HDDs, and other things. I personally use this card for the Xbox 360, works perfect to flash iXtreme to any drive.

Cons: The SATA port on the back did not work when I got it. Also when I put the card in my PC my PC wouldn't boot at first! I had to flash the bios and then update the BIOS before this card was recognized. I didn't install any drivers and still works great.

Other Thoughts: Only tested on 32-bit XP, but ordered a second and will install it into my other PC running a triple boot of 64-Bit Vista, 64-Bit XP and Windows 7

Bottomline: Excellent card!

Pros: This pci card is perfect for flashing xbox 360 dvd, liteon included.
Great if you don't have an internal sata controller or your internal one isn't the right chipset.
The price is very good.
The card has one external sata connecter and two internal sata connectors, what is very handy.

Cons: Can't find any negative about this product.

Other Thoughts: I don't have any problems installing this pci card on windows xp (with the cd) or with windows xp mediacenter2005 or with windows vista, the last one doesn't even need drivers. Didn't have a chance to test windows 7.

Bottomline: Good working pci satacard, works great for flashing xbox 360 dvd (all). You don't even need to install the drivers.
Very low price for what you get.

Pros: None I can see. I wanted this card to try to recover an old raid array installed on a mobo with a via chipset which died.

Cons: Didn't work on Vista x64, didn't work on Windows 7 x64, and that's all I have.

Other Thoughts: If it had worked, it could helped recovering data on an old raid array (whose old mobo died). The card seems not to be dead, since it cause some slow downs on the system, but installation program says it can not find the supported hardware on my system.

Bottomline: Maybe it works for Windows XP, I don't know.

Pros: Works perfectly with FreeNAS. Totally outperforms some well know brand cards based on the same chip.
Build quality is good. The external port is SATA (not e-sata) that is very useful for me.
Out of the box support for HDDs greater than 500GB.
No boot delays(card BIOS messages not displayed)
In my card, no appreciable defects where found

Cons: The docs and driver CD was a little hard to read in a standard CD drive, bud worked fine in a new DVD drive. Anyway, if you're about to use it in FreeNAS or FreeBSD the CD has no use for you.

Other Thoughts: Solved my 'interrupt storm detected on "irqXX:"; throttling interrupt source' problem on FreeNAS.

Bottomline: If you are looking to build a cheap FreeNAS server from an old motherboard without SATA support, this is the card for you. I'm really surprised with the excellent performance for the low price.
